    摘要: The high current capabilities of a lateral npn transistor for application as a protection device against degradation due to electrostatic discharge (ESD) events are improved by adjusting the electrical resistivity of the material through which the collector current flows from the avalanching pn-junction to the wafer backside contact. As expressed in terms of the second threshold current improvements by a factor of 4 are reported. Two implant sequences are described which apply local masking and standard implant conditions to achieve the improvements without adding to the total number of process steps. The principle of p-well engineering is extended to ESD protection devices employing SCR-type devices.

    摘要: A system for exchanging information content between a back-end system within a restricted access environment and an end-user includes a front-end system and a manager node outside of the restricted environment, and an access node within the restricted environment. The front-end system executes a mini-application to output query data. The manager node receives the query data and applies business logic and connection parameters to generate a request for the information content in a first format. The manager node communicates the request to the access node in the first format. The access node converts the request to a second format particular to the back-end system, and conveys the request to the back-end system. Responses containing the information content are received at the access node from the back-end system. The access node converts the responses to the first format and sends information content contained in the responses to the front-end system via the manager node.

    摘要: Technologies for monitoring system API calls include a computing device with hardware virtualization support. The computing device establishes a default memory view and a security memory view to define physical memory maps and permissions. The computing device executes an application in the default memory view and executes a default inline hook in response to a call to an API function. The default inline hook switches to the security memory view using hardware support without causing a virtual machine exit. The security inline hook calls a security callback function to validate the API function call in the security memory view. Hook-skipping attacks may be prevented by padding the default inline hook with no-operation instructions, by designating memory pages of the API function as non-executable in the default memory view, or by designating memory pages of the application as non-executable in the security memory view.     摘要: A process integration system to interface between a sender system and a receiver system is described. The process integration system has a sender adapter, an integration engine, a receiver adapter, and a language converter module. The sender adapter receives a communication in a first language from the sender system. The communication is in a first format of the sender system. The sender adapter converts the communication into a second format of the process integration system, and the integration engine identifies the receiver system from the communication in the second format. The receiver adapter converts the communication from the second format to a third format of the receiver system, and sends the communication in the third format and in a second language to the receiver system. The language converter module translates the communication in the third format to the second language associated with the receiver system.

    摘要: An aneurysm occlusion system includes devices positionable within a cerebral blood vessel covering a neck of an aneurysm in the blood vessel. A component device includes an expandable tubular body, an expandable anchor, and a link connecting the body to the anchor. One or more devices deployed using a method according to the invention includes a novel feature that guarantees that the distal high coverage segment aligns with the neck of the aneurysm. A single device or multiple devices, used in conjunction with an embolic material or coil, may be combined to form a system according to the invention. When positioned and deployed strategically either alone or with a second device utilizing a method according to the invention, the system has a high coverage region covering a neck of an aneurysm, and a gap between the system and healthy vessel. The system and method prevent blood flow into an aneurysm while permitting blood flow through healthy vessel.
